1. Downtown Mesa
Downtown Mesa is the heart of the city, featuring a vibrant arts scene, restaurants, and shopping. The area has seen significant revitalization in recent years, making it an attractive location for renters.
- Close proximity to public transportation
- Access to cultural events and festivals
- Variety of housing options, from apartments to townhomes
2. East Mesa
East Mesa is known for its family-friendly atmosphere and excellent schools. This area is popular among families and young professionals, making it a prime location for rental properties.
- Strong school districts
- Proximity to parks and recreational areas
- Variety of single-family homes and condos
3. Red Mountain Ranch
Red Mountain Ranch is a well-established community known for its beautiful homes and scenic views. This neighborhood offers a mix of luxury and affordability, attracting a diverse group of renters.
- Access to golf courses and hiking trails
- Community amenities such as pools and clubhouses
- Strong sense of community and safety
4. Mesa Grande
Mesa Grande is a growing neighborhood that appeals to both students and young professionals. Its proximity to educational institutions makes it a popular choice for renters.
- Close to Mesa Community College
- Affordable rental options
- Access to public transportation
5. Superstition Springs
Superstition Springs is a suburban neighborhood that offers a mix of shopping, dining, and entertainment options. This area is ideal for families and individuals looking for a relaxed lifestyle.
- Proximity to Superstition Springs Center
- Access to outdoor activities and parks
- Variety of rental properties including townhomes and apartments
6. Alta Mesa
Alta Mesa is known for its spacious homes and family-friendly environment. The neighborhood is well-maintained and offers a range of amenities that appeal to renters.
- Access to quality schools and parks
- Strong community involvement
- Variety of housing styles, including single-family homes
7. Lehi
Lehi is a unique neighborhood that combines agricultural land with residential properties. This area is becoming increasingly popular among renters looking for a more rural feel while still being close to city amenities.
- Proximity to local farms and markets
- Quiet atmosphere with spacious lots
- Growing rental market with new developments
